Remember too that some 8051 variants have more ports, watch the package too. The Winbond W77C32 I use has five ports if I get it in a TQFP package. I also saw an ad recently for a new Cynal part that has eight ports (and 100 MIPS!). You didn't say what your pin count requirements are for your sensors and servos. Also, since you can't read three ports at *exactly* the same time, there is always the option of latching the data externally and multiplexing the data in on a single port. Just depends on what your requirements really are. Good luck, Dennis |
